Endodontics

Q1: The labiolingual dimension of maxillary canine pulp chamber is _______its mesiodistal dimension.

A. shorter than

B. wider than

C. equal to

D. similar to

Answer: wider than


Q2: In mandibular incisors, dimensions of the pulp canal remain similar at all levels.

Mandibular central incisor is the smallest tooth in the arch.

A. both statements are true

B. both statements are false

C. the first statement is true, the second is false

D. the first statement is false, the second is true

Answer: the first statement is false, the second is true

Q3: Which of the following are the morphological characteristics of maxillary first premolar?

A. presence of pulp horn under each cusp

B. larger palatal orifice compared to buccal orifice

C. pulp chamber wider buccolingually than mesiodistally

D. all of the above

Answer: all of the above

Q7: Which of the following is a clinical diagnosis based on subjective and objective findings indicating that
the vital inflamed pulp is incapable of healing and has the following additional descriptors: lingering thermal
pain, spontaneous pain, and referred pain?

A. reversible pulpitis

B. asymptomatic irreversible pulpitis

C. symptomatic irreversible pulpits

D. none of the above

Answer: symptomatic irreversible pulpitis

, Q8: Which of the following is an inflammatory reaction to pulpal infection and necrosis characterized by
rapid onset, spontaneous pain, tenderness of the tooth to pressure, pus formation and swelling of
associated tissues?

A. symptomatic apical periodontitis

B. acute apical abscess

C. chronic apical abscess

D. asymptomatic apical periodontitis

Answer: acute apical abscess
